Output 08e61f0b3fc401864e3ad2b38bd9814aed147f077e0663ca18f8dfb4f5477012:0

value
6566428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fc67d9e7455bd48a5d7c6b85481c58cab22601e OP_EQUAL
address
3KB2mZNSbpmPJN6LiLZD828JwC3nJ1Y7Tb
transaction
08e61f0b3fc401864e3ad2b38bd9814aed147f077e0663ca18f8dfb4f5477012
confirmations
392593
spent
true